Key Insights
The European feed enzyme market is projected for robust expansion, driven by escalating demand for animal protein, a growing emphasis on sustainable and efficient animal feed, and stringent regulations promoting feed efficiency. The market is estimated at 3974 million in the base year 2024, with a projected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 6.1%. This growth is underpinned by several key drivers. Increased global protein demand necessitates enhanced animal feed formulations that improve nutrient digestibility, thereby reducing costs and environmental impact. Furthermore, stricter regulations on antibiotic use in animal feed are accelerating the adoption of feed enzymes for improved animal health and productivity. Technological advancements in enzyme development, including specialized multi-enzyme complexes, are also contributing significantly to market growth.

Key Markets & Segments Leading Europe Feed Enzyme Market
The European Feed Enzyme market is characterized by diverse regional and segmental performance. While Germany and France represent the largest national markets, significant growth is anticipated in countries like Turkey and the rest of Europe, driven by increasing livestock production and rising awareness of sustainable feed practices.
Dominant Segments:
- Animal Type: Swine and poultry remain the leading animal segments, driven by intensive farming practices and the high demand for animal protein. However, aquaculture is witnessing rapid growth due to the increasing global consumption of seafood.
- Enzyme Type: Phytases dominate the market due to their critical role in improving phosphorus utilization, reducing environmental impact, and enhancing feed efficiency. Carbohydrases are another significant segment, contributing to improved digestibility and nutrient utilization.

Key Milestones in Europe Feed Enzyme Market Industry
- December 2021: BASF and Cargill extended their animal nutrition partnership, expanding market reach and R&D capabilities.
- January 2022: DSM-Novozymes alliance launched Hiphorius, a next-generation phytase, enhancing poultry production efficiency.
- July 2022: Cargill partnered with Innovafeed to provide innovative, nutritious ingredients for aquaculture, strengthening its presence in this growing segment.
